Company Overview
ActiveProspect is the SaaS platform on a mission to make consent-based marketing the most scalable, efficient, and safest method for customer acquisition.
Our comprehensive product suite empowers companies across industries to take real-time action on their leads, protect themselves from litigation by documenting proof of consent, and save money by providing new levels of data insights and control.
Job Summary
We’re looking for a mid or senior level Node.js engineer to work on our high volume, high availability platform, LeadConduit. LeadConduit is responsible for handling expensive data, so we’re seeking someone with experience building scalable, secure, and performant solutions using Node.js. You will work on LeadConduit's customer facing API and the architecture and backend that supports it. Collaborating with the rest of the LeadConduit team, you will move our platform into the next phase of its life.
Responsibilities
ActiveProspect is the SaaS platform on a mission to make consent-based marketing the most scalable, efficient, and safest method for customer acquisition.
Our comprehensive product suite empowers companies across industries to take real-time action on their leads, protect themselves from litigation by documenting proof of consent, and save money by providing new levels of data insights and control.
Job Summary
We’re looking for a mid or senior level Node.js engineer to work on our high volume, high availability platform, LeadConduit. LeadConduit is responsible for handling expensive data, so we’re seeking someone with experience building scalable, secure, and performant solutions using Node.js. You will work on LeadConduit's customer facing API and the architecture and backend that supports it. Collaborating with the rest of the LeadConduit team, you will move our platform into the next phase of its life.
Responsibilities
- Build RESTful APIs and back end services
- Ship clean, well-tested, and highly observable code to production on a regular basis
- Participate in planning to iterate and continuously improve the product
- Perform code reviews and mentor junior engineers
- Collaborate on design specifications and communicate trade-offs of different approaches
- Troubleshoot production issues
- Write clear technical documentation
- Expert understanding of JavaScript and Node.js
- 3+ years experience with Node.js
- Experience designing and implementing RESTful APIs and services using Node.js
- Experience with MongoDB
- Experience publishing npm modules
- Experience with git, pull requests, and automated testing
- Experience working on a small team, where clear, efficient, and respectful communication is critical
- Experience working with Online Lead Generation Marketing
- Experience with AWS, Elasticsearch
- Operational experience with MongoDB
- Understanding of serverless / microservice / cloud infrastructure and data pipelines
- Experience working in a DevOps environment using automated builds, testing and deployment
- Flexible work schedule
- Work anywhere that makes you happy (i.e. fully remote)
- Work-life balance that emphasizes the "life" part
- Paid attendance to at least one tech conference of per year
- Unlimited PTO
- Retirement plan matching up to 3% of your salary
- Company subsidized health, dental, vision, disability and life insurance
- A financially stable company, with the freedom and opportunities of a startup culture